The swimming pool is a great place to have fun, relax, and stay in shape. Because of the changing weather conditions, swimming pools cannot be used in the autumn and winter in most of the northern and Midwest states. In some places, swimming pools are too cold to swim in as early as late August. To keep them usable throughout the year, you can have solar heaters for swimming pools installed. Solar heater pools Solar pool heaters absorb infrared radiation from the sun. The dark solar panels that come with the heating assembly attracts energy. These panels measure four feet x 10 feet each. A regular solar heater kit for a swimming pool includes two panels. The panels come with stands, and they can easily be erected in gardens and patios. Solar heaters for swimming pools also come with cables that are attached to the swimming pool's filtration system. A solar heater kit costs $250. When the pool's filtration system is turned on, the solar panels in the solar heater begin absorbing energy from the sun. They become hot to touch, and after reaching a certain temperature, the solar panels begin to cool rapidly. The heat is transferred through the cables and into the water. The solar panels continue to absorb heat as long as the filtration system is on, raising the temperature of the pool water by as much as 10 degrees Fahrenheit. Indoor pool heaters solar Most indoor pools do not get unbearably cold, but you can still use indoor solar pool heaters on them. The solar panels are mounted on the roof. Long heat transfer cables connect from the panels to the filtration system near the pool. Indoor pool heaters solar work the same way as other solar heaters for swimming pools do. Because the cables are much longer than other models, they are more expensive. They cost$300 to $400. Home built solar pool heaters Building home furnishings can be fun and fulfilling, so some homeowners prefer home built solar pool heaters. The materials found in a typical package of solar heaters for swimming pools can be bought individually, and assembled and connected as the homeowners see fit. The package should contain at least two solar panels, stands or props for the panels, and heat transfer cables. These materials cost between $180 and $200. Safety and other considerations There are several safety considerations when operating solar heaters for swimming pools. Do not touch the solar panels while they are gathering energy. They become very hot. Combustible and plastic items should be kept away from the solar panels at all times. Also, never leave the solar panels exposed to the cold. They are notoriously sensitive to low temperatures, and they crack easily in the winter. Bring them inside the house when not in use. |
